Akshay Shinde, 23, a contract sweeper at the school, was arrested on August 17 and held in police custody for three days, ending on Wednesday. He faces charges under various laws, including the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ences (POCSO) Act, for the grievous crimes committed against two girls, aged 4 and 6, in the school toilet on August 12-13. The incident has triggered a state-wide outcry.
